Security readout for executives and security teams
Plain-English summary
IBM Cloud Pak System 2.3 has an information disclosure issue where a local user may, in some situations, view another user's artifacts in the self-service console. The business impact is limited confidentiality exposure, not data modification or outage, based on the published CVSS vector.
Executive priority
Treat as a moderate-priority confidentiality issue. Prioritize remediation where Cloud Pak System hosts sensitive artifacts or has many console users, but it is not described as remote code execution, privilege escalation, or service disruption.
Technical view
CVE-2021-20478 affects IBM Cloud Pak System 2.3. IBM describes a local information disclosure condition in the self-service console. CVSS 3.0 score is 4.0 with local attack vector, low complexity, no user interaction, and low confidentiality impact only.
Likely exposure
Exposure appears limited to organizations running IBM Cloud Pak System 2.3 where users can access the affected self-service console context. The source bundle does not identify other versions or products as affected.
Exploitation context
The source bundle does not show CISA KEV listing or cited evidence of active exploitation. IBM X-Force lists the vulnerability, but the provided data does not include public exploit status or exploit details.
Researcher notes
No CWE is listed in the source bundle. CVSS vector is CVSS:3.0/S:U/A:N/I:N/C:L/AV:L/AC:L/UI:N/PR:N/E:U/RL:O/RC:C. The details are sparse, so avoid assuming exploitability beyond local information disclosure in the self-service console.
Mitigation direction
- Review IBM advisory 6473065 for the official remediation path.
- Apply IBM-provided fixes or updates validated for Cloud Pak System 2.3.
- Limit access to the self-service console to authorized users.
- Review artifact visibility and tenant/user separation controls.
- Monitor IBM X-Force entry 197497 for updated guidance.
Validation and detection
- Confirm whether IBM Cloud Pak System 2.3 is deployed.
- Identify users with local or self-service console access.
- Check whether IBM advisory remediation has been applied.
- Review logs for unusual artifact access across users.
- Validate artifact isolation after remediation in a test environment.
